Develop the life-changing ability to excel in spontaneous communication situations—from public speaking to interviewing to networking—with these essential strategies from a Stanford lecturer, coach, and host of the popular Think Fast, Talk Smart The Podcast 。

Many of us dread having to convey our ideas to others, often feeling ill-equipped, anxious, and awkward。 Public speaking experts help by focusing on planned communication experiences such as slide presentations, pitches, or formal talks。 Yet, most of our professional and personal communication occurs in spontaneous situations that creep up on us and all too often leave us flustered and stumbling for words。 How can we rise to the occasion and shine when we’re put on the spot?

In Think Faster, Talk Smarter , Stanford lecturer, podcast host, and communication expert Matt Abrahams provides tangible, actionable skills to help even the most anxious of speakers succeed when speaking spontaneously。 Abrahams provides science-based strategies for managing anxiety, responding to the mood of the room, and making content concise, relevant, compelling, and memorable。 Drawing on stories from his clients and students, he offers best practices for navigating Q&A sessions, shining in job interviews, providing effective feedback, making small talk, fixing faux pas, persuading others, and handling other impromptu speaking tasks。

Whether it’s a prospective client asking you an unexpected question during a meeting or all eyes turning to you at a dinner party, you’ll know how to navigate the situation like a pro and bring out your very best。 Think Faster, Talk Smarter is an accessible guide to communication that will help you master new techniques in no time。

Spontaneous speaking can be quite challenging and scary。 But in Matt Abrahams' book, those techniques have been described that will prepare you for comfortable and confident spontaneous speaking。Abrahams first deals with all of our anxiety and how it can be reduced, starting from mindfulness and breathing techniques to positive self-talk and avoiding jargon。 The point is clear - if you are anxious then you will be distracted and have trouble connecting with your audience。 So calming your mind first is essential。Then Abrahams teaches how to embrace our spontaneity by leaving perfectionism。 According to him, there is no 'right' or 'perfect' way in spontaneous speaking - there are only better and worse ways。 The less we judge ourselves and just keep connecting, the better it is。 The pursuit of perfection kills our creativity and increases our anxiety。Continue reading the review here: https://www。keetabikeeda。in/post/mast。。。 。。。more

I was really pleased to get the opportunity to read an advance copy of this book。 I've listened to several episodes of Matt Abrahams' podcast on communication and find it a fascinating and, for me, very relevant subject。I have a job in which communication is really important and I'm definitely a words person。 However while I'm confident in written communication, verbally - especially off the cuff - is a different matter。 I flounder, can't find words, fail to finish sentences, and lose my train o I was really pleased to get the opportunity to read an advance copy of this book。 I've listened to several episodes of Matt Abrahams' podcast on communication and find it a fascinating and, for me, very relevant subject。I have a job in which communication is really important and I'm definitely a words person。 However while I'm confident in written communication, verbally - especially off the cuff - is a different matter。 I flounder, can't find words, fail to finish sentences, and lose my train of thought。 So, I was very keen to learn some strategies and techniques for communicating better "in the moment"。Matt Abrahams definitely provides these, with numerous very practical ideas, techniques and examples。 Part I discusses a six step methodology to improving our ability to speak spontaneously; Part II considers specific situations such as small talk, pitching, giving feedback to others。 He uses a lot of "formulas" to structure the content of what we are saying - I can see these are effective - the only issue for me is likely to be (a) remembering them and (b) remembering to apply them in the moment! I'll probably need to reread a lot of these sections to internalise it a bit more。 He does provide lots of ideas for trying out the techniques so there's no excuse really for not using and benefiting from them。 I guess it's all about practice。。。。A very interesting and approachable read which does what it promises and which I'm sure will be very helpful to all those of us who tend to freeze, panic and waffle when put on the spot。 。。。more
